Length of Wood Screws
The length of a wood screw is measured from the tip to the underside of the head. Choosing the correct length is essential for ensuring that the screw provides adequate holding power without splitting the wood. As a general rule, the screw should penetrate at least one-third to one-half the thickness of the material it is fastening.
For example, if you are joining two pieces of wood that are each 1 inch thick, a screw that is at least 1.5 inches long would be appropriate. This ensures that the screw has enough thread engagement in both pieces of wood to provide a strong hold.
Diameter of Wood Screws
The diameter of a wood screw, often referred to as the gauge, is another critical dimension. The diameter determines the size of the hole the screw will create and the amount of holding power it will provide. Wood screw diameters are typically measured in fractions of an inch or in millimeters.
Common diameters for wood screws include:
- #6 (1/8 inch or 3.2 mm)
- #8 (5/32 inch or 4 mm)
- #10 (3/16 inch or 4.8 mm)
- #12 (7/32 inch or 5.5 mm)
Choosing the right diameter depends on the type of wood and the specific application. For softer woods like pine, a smaller diameter screw may be sufficient, while harder woods like oak may require a larger diameter for better holding power.
Thread Pitch of Wood Screws
The thread pitch refers to the distance between the threads on the screw. This dimension affects how easily the screw can be driven into the wood and how well it holds. A finer thread pitch provides more threads per inch, which can be beneficial for harder woods or applications requiring a tighter hold.
Coarser thread pitches are generally used for softer woods or applications where faster driving is desired. Understanding the thread pitch can help you select the right wood screw for your project, ensuring optimal performance and durability.
Head Styles of Wood Screws
The head style of a wood screw determines how it will be driven and how it will sit flush with the surface of the wood. Common head styles include:
- Flathead
- Panhead
- Roundhead
- Ovalhead
- Trusshead
Each head style has its own advantages and is suited to different applications. For example, flathead screws are often used when a flush finish is required, while panhead screws are ideal for applications where the head needs to sit slightly above the surface.

Common Wood Screw Dimensions
Here is a table outlining some common wood screw dimensions and their typical applications:
| Screw Size | Diameter | Length | Typical Applications |
|---|---|---|---|
| #6 x 1 inch | 1/8 inch (3.2 mm) | 1 inch (25.4 mm) | Light-duty projects, hanging pictures |
| #8 x 1.5 inches | 5/32 inch (4 mm) | 1.5 inches (38.1 mm) | Medium-duty projects, cabinetry |
| #10 x 2 inches | 3/16 inch (4.8 mm) | 2 inches (50.8 mm) | Heavy-duty projects, furniture assembly |
| #12 x 2.5 inches | 7/32 inch (5.5 mm) | 2.5 inches (63.5 mm) | Structural projects, deck building |
📝 Note: These dimensions are general guidelines. Always refer to the specific requirements of your project and the manufacturer's recommendations for the best results.
Special Considerations for Wood Screw Dimensions
In addition to the standard dimensions, there are a few special considerations to keep in mind when selecting wood screws:
- Material Compatibility: Ensure that the screw material is compatible with the type of wood you are working with. For example, stainless steel screws are ideal for outdoor projects where exposure to moisture and weathering is a concern.
- Coating and Finish: Some wood screws come with special coatings or finishes that enhance their performance. For instance, screws with a zinc or phosphate coating can provide better corrosion resistance.
- Drill Point: The design of the screw's tip can affect how easily it penetrates the wood. A sharp, self-drilling point can make it easier to drive the screw without pre-drilling a pilot hole.
By considering these factors, you can choose wood screws that are not only dimensionally appropriate but also optimized for the specific conditions of your project.
